health - Correct Answers-As a state of complete physical, mental, and social well-being, not
merely the absence of disease or infirmity.



model - Correct Answers-a theoretical way of understanding a concept or an idea. They
represent various ways of approaching complex issues.



Health Beliefs - Correct Answers-A person's ideas, convictions, and attitudes about health and
illness. These influence health behavior so they can positively or negatively affect a patient's
level of health.



Health Belief Model - Correct Answers-Conceptual framework that describes a person's health
behavior as an expression of the person's health beliefs. Addresses the relationship b/n a
person's beliefs and behaviors. It provides way of understanding and predicting how pts will
behave in relation to their health and how successful they'll be in following health care
therapies or regimens.



Positive Health Behaviors - Correct Answers-activities related to maintaining, attaining, or
regaining good health and preventing illness.



List some common positive health behaviors. - Correct Answers-Getting immunizations,
maintaining proper sleep patterns, getting adequate exercise, and eating healthy foods.



Negative Health Behaviors - Correct Answers-activities that are harmful to health.

,List some negative health behaviors. - Correct Answers-Smoking, abusing drugs or alcohol,
following a poor diet, and refusing to take necessary medications.



Health Promotion - Correct Answers-behavior motivated by desire to increase well-being and
actualize human health potential



Health protection - Correct Answers-behavior motivated by the desire to avoid illness, detect it
early, or maintain function within the constraints of an illness



Holistic Health - Correct Answers-generally comprehensive view of person as a biopsychosocial
and spiritual being



health beliefs - Correct Answers-person's ideas and attitudes about health



health practices - Correct Answers-activities individuals perform to care for themselves



Passive strategies of health promotion - Correct Answers-where individuals gain from the
activities of others without acting themselves



active strategies of health promotion - Correct Answers-individuals adopt specific health
programs



health promotion - Correct Answers-activities that help patients maintain of enhance their
present levels of health and reduce risks for developing certain diseases



wellness education - Correct Answers-teaches people how to care for themselves in a healthy
way

,illness prevention - Correct Answers-activities that protect patients from actual or potential
threats to health



primary prevention - Correct Answers-True prevention. Precedes disease or dysfunction. Applies
to patients considered physically and emotionally healthy. Purpose it to decrease vulnerability
of individual or population to illness or dysfunction. Includes passive and active strategies of
health promotion.



Describe secondary prevention - Correct Answers-Focuses on people who are experiencing
health problems or illness and who are at risk for developing complications or worsening
conditions. Directs activities at diagnosis and prompt intervention, thereby reducing severity
and enabling patients to return to normal level of health as early as possible. Includes screening
techniques and treating early stages of disease.



Describe tertiary prevention - Correct Answers-occurs when defect or disability is permanent,
irreversible, and stabilized. Involves minimizing effects of long-term disease or disability by
interventions directed at preventing complications and deterioration. Activities are for rehab
rather than diagnosis and treatment.



Risk Factor - Correct Answers-any situation, habit, environmental condition, physiological
condition, or other variable that increases vulnerability of an individual or a group to an illness
or accident.



illness - Correct Answers-state in which a person's physical, emotional, intellectual, social,
developmental, or spiritual functioning is diminished or impaired compared with previous
experience.



acute illness - Correct Answers-usually short term and severe. Symptoms appear abruptly, are
intense, and often subside after relatively short period.

, chronic illness - Correct Answers-usually lasts longer than 6 months. Patients fluctuate between
maximal functioning and serious health relapses



illness behaviors - Correct Answers-how people behave when they're sick



levels of health care - Correct Answers-preventive, primary, secondary, tertiary, restorative, and
continuing care



preventive care - Correct Answers-blood pressure and cancer screening, immunizations, poison
control information, mental health counseling and crisis prevention, and community legislation
(seat belts, air bags)



Primary care - Correct Answers-"health promotion" like prenatal care, well-baby care, nutrition
counseling, family planning, exercise classes



secondary care - Correct Answers-emergency care, acute medical-surgical care, and radiological
procedures



tertiary care - Correct Answers-intensive care, psychiatric facilities



restorative care - Correct Answers-cardiovascular and pulmonary rehab, sports medicine, spinal
cord injury programs, and home care



continuing care - Correct Answers-assisted living and psychiatric and older adult day care



autonomy - Correct Answers-means that a person is reasonably independent and self-governing
in decision making and practice.
